Commit d760fc37b0f74502b3f748951f22c6683b079a8e caused 
1G functions to allocate rx rings which were 1/10 of the 
size of 10G functions' rx rings.

However, it also caused 10G functions on 5771x boards to 
allocate small rings, which limits their possible (default) 
rx throughput. This patch causes all 10G functions to use 
rings of intended length by default.

 drivers/net/ethernet/broadcom/bnx2x/bnx2x_cmn.c |   17 ++++++++++-------
 1 files changed, 10 insertions(+), 7 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/net/ethernet/broadcom/bnx2x/bnx2x_cmn.c b/drivers/net/ethernet/broadcom/bnx2x/bnx2x_cmn.c
index 30f04a3..2422099 100644
--- a/drivers/net/ethernet/broadcom/bnx2x/bnx2x_cmn.c
+++ b/drivers/net/ethernet/broadcom/bnx2x/bnx2x_cmn.c
@@ -3523,15 +3523,18 @@ static int bnx2x_alloc_fp_mem_at(struct bnx2x *bp, int index)
 	} else
 #endif
 	if (!bp->rx_ring_size) {
-		u32 cfg = SHMEM_RD(bp,
-			     dev_info.port_hw_config[BP_PORT(bp)].default_cfg);
-
 		rx_ring_size = MAX_RX_AVAIL/BNX2X_NUM_RX_QUEUES(bp);
 
-		/* Dercease ring size for 1G functions */
-		if ((cfg & PORT_HW_CFG_NET_SERDES_IF_MASK) ==
-		    PORT_HW_CFG_NET_SERDES_IF_SGMII)
-			rx_ring_size /= 10;
+		if (CHIP_IS_E3(bp)) {
+			u32 cfg = SHMEM_RD(bp,
+					   dev_info.port_hw_config[BP_PORT(bp)].
+					   default_cfg);
+
+			/* Decrease ring size for 1G functions */
+			if ((cfg & PORT_HW_CFG_NET_SERDES_IF_MASK) ==
+			    PORT_HW_CFG_NET_SERDES_IF_SGMII)
+				rx_ring_size /= 10;
+		}
 
 		/* allocate at least number of buffers required by FW */
 		rx_ring_size = max_t(int, bp->disable_tpa ? MIN_RX_SIZE_NONTPA :
